Mahidol University Short Term Visiting Scholar Scholarship 2025
Mahidol University is offering an exciting opportunity for short-term visiting scholars under its Fiscal Year 2025 Scholarship Program. This initiative aims to strengthen academic collaboration, enhance research and publications, and foster meaningful interactions between the university’s students and international scholars. It is a valuable opportunity for foreign instructors, researchers, and experts from academic institutions, national research organizations, or intergovernmental organizations to engage in innovative academic exchange with one of Thailand’s premier institutions.
The scholarship is open to scholars from ASEAN, ASEAN+6 countries, and beyond, including those from Europe, the Americas, and other regions. Eligible candidates must have expertise in their fields and receive approval from their original institutions to apply. The scholarship offers flexibility in engagement, allowing recipients to work onsite at Mahidol University, participate in online work, or a hybrid model combining both. Scholars can choose durations ranging from two to 12 weeks, with financial support covering airfare, accommodation, meals, visa fees, health insurance, and other expenses. Online-only participants and hybrid work arrangements are also supported with specific compensations.
The program prioritizes deliverables that enhance academic output, such as co-authored publications, development of courses or laboratories, and providing consultations to Mahidol University’s students and faculty. Scholars are also expected to actively participate in seminars, workshops, or conferences to build robust academic networks within the university.
Applications are carefully reviewed based on the relevance of the candidate’s expertise, proposed deliverables, and their ability to contribute to the university’s academic environment. The program ensures transparency and fairness in selection, with clear guidelines for application submission, scholarship allocation, and performance monitoring.
